Chapter the first:Nightmares of an orphan

It was a beautiful day in Mystic Ruins. The clouds were floating lazily across the sky, and the birds were singing a tune. As it happened, on this particular day, Tails the fox was carrying out an important experiment. He was using some new chemicals he had bought on Ebay. He was trying to create a more efficient fuel for the Tornado. He was just on the brink of a big discovery when a gust blew his door shut. He smiled. He walked into his living room to see one of his best friends and heroes on his chair, watching his television. Sonic grinned at his pal. “Sorry Tails, but your T.V has the best resolution in the world!” he explained.
“You only watch T.V when you know you’re on the news. So what did you do this time?” Tails asked.
“I put out a raging forest fire.” Sonic said, puffing his chest out.
“Just like last week.” Tails replied smugly.
Sonic frowned. Tails was 10 now, and had discovered what sarcasm was in a big way. Still, Sonic was secretly proud of the way Tails was turning out. Having been almost like an adopted big brother to the fox, Sonic felt almost as if Tails was his responsibility. Secretly, Sonic wondered how long it would be before Tails got himself a girlfriend. He smiled as he watched a blue blur put out a raging forest fire on the T.V.

Knuckles was channelling powerful chaos energy on Angel island. He was waiting, watching. He could feel a familiar presence from far away. But he could also feel another, much more familiar presence that was a lot closer. He frowned as he realised who it was. Another day, another attempt to steal my emerald by that conniving bat, he thought to himself. He seemed to see a lot more of Rouge these days. Privately, he was in two minds about these frequent visits. He was annoyed at the fact that she wanted to steal the emerald, of course. But what was that other feeling he had when he saw her? It wasn’t anger, or annoyance. So what was it? He groaned and got up. He walked out and prepared to protect the island.

“Can I have that one? Can I, can I?”
Vanilla smiled as her daughter took out a new dress from the rack. She, Cream and Amy were shopping. Cream showed her mother the dress she had picked. It was orange, with a white zig-zagged hem and collar. It seemed to suit Cream perfectly. “Any particular reason for that dress, Cream?” Amy said, looking at her.
“Well, I just like it! That’s all! Can we buy it?” Cream asked.
“Sure.”, Vanilla said.
Cheese fluttered around Cream’s head, making high pitched squeaks. Cream laughed, and went over to the tie rack to search for a new bowtie for him. Afterwards, they brought their shopping to the counter. As Cream and Cheese rushed of to the next shop, Amy walked alongside Vanilla.
“Tell me truthfully, Vanilla. Who does that dress remind you of?” asked Amy, pointing to Cream’s new dress.
“Well, Amy, it reminds me of a certain two-tailed fox who just so happens to be a good friend of my daughter.” Vanilla said, smiling.
“I think that’s who it reminds her of, too…” Amy said thoughtfully.

Tails bade Sonic farewell, and returned to work on his experiment. He thought about his friends as he worked. Sonic, his ‘big brother’, Knuckles, the reliable yet stubborn martial artist, Amy, the love-struck hedgehog, Rouge, the greedy jewel thief, Shadow, the enigmatic ebony hedgehog, Charmy, a good if slightly annoying friend, Vanilla, a kind, caring rabbit and Cream. For some reason, Tails could never figure out what he thought about Cream. Cream was, well, Cream, he had concluded. There was no other way he was willing to describe her. It was nighttime now, and Tails decided it was time to hit the hay. As he tucked himself up in bed, he had a sudden longing for the mother he couldn’t remember. It occurred to him that he had been tucking himself into bed for as long as he could remember. He frowned, and rolled over to try and get some sleep.

Tails was flying, flying higher than he had ever flown before. The sky was a perfect blue, and the clouds seemed like puffy balls of white cotton wool above him. A flock of birds passed him, and Tails saw they were like no birds he had ever seen before. They were different colours- Red, Green, Blue, Orange, Grey…All the colours of the rainbow. All the colours of the chaos emeralds. A flock of birds flew right at Tails, knocking him off his flight path. Suddenly, his world started going down. He had lost his ability to fly! He fell through the sky to the sound of deep, rumbling laughter. He screamed out, but the unrelenting laughter drowned out his voice. Down below, Tails saw Sonic running along below him, trying to catch him. But he was so slow! He wasn’t going to make it in time! He was about to hit the ground. Tails imagined himself flat on the ground, nothing more than a red smear to mark where he had hit the ground. He imagined the sound he would make on the floor. He wondered whether he would thud or squish. Sonic was still speeding along, but there was no way he could get there now. Tails closed his eyes and prepared for the impact. But the impact never came. He felt wind a gust of wind carrying him upwards into the sky. He opened his eyes and saw another flock of the birds, the chaos gulls, flying toward him. As he was enveloped in a storm of birds, a bright, pure light flashed behind him. He looked back and saw a creature that seemed to be made of pure energy carrying him. It stared at him with deep, wise blue eyes.

“Tails! Tails! Wake up!”
Tails' world fuzzed into view as he opened his eyes. Sonic was standing above him, looking concerned.
“What happened?” Sonic asked.
“I was having a nightmare…I think…” Tails replied drowsily.
He was still groggy. His workshop, covered with spare parts, was fuzzy and hard to understand.
“What time is it?” yawned Tails.
“11 o’ clock. Why?” his high speed friend asked.
“Darn! I said I’d meet Cream at the park at noon! I need to get going!” Tails cried.
Sonic smiled. Naturally, he had noticed that Tails was more than a little lonely on his own in his workshop, so he had arranged that Tails and Cream would meet up and go to a funfair a couple of months ago. Both had enjoyed it and decided to meet up regularly. Sonic watched his friend trying franticly to groom his coat so it wasn’t messy. Tails had started suffering from bed fur recently, and although Tails didn’t admit it, he was proud of his sleek, glossy fur.
Tails was finally ready to go when Sonic stopped him.
“Look, Tails, if you ever have anything you want to get off your chest, I’m here for you.” Sonic said in a kindly voice. He needn’t have bothered though. When he looked up, he saw a pair of tails disappearing out of the workshop door.

A long way away, a creature left its companions and looked at the sky. Soon, it thought, you will be in grave danger once again. But will I get there in time to save you this time?
